Buying from China using Western Union Money Teransfer?
Hi all, I have a small home run ebay business selling motorcycle parts and recently i registered with 2 websites for importing from China. Alibaba.com and Made in China.com. After various emails back and forth a deal was struck with several suppliers all of which sent me invoices asking me to pay via Western Union Money Transfer but i've heard some horror stories buying this way. Does anyone have any advice for me? Thank You

The fundamental principle about using Western Union is that it is safe if you know or trust the recipient, but risky if you don't. PayPal is much better, but they would have to register in China with a bank account. Another possibility, is for you to open a Bank of China account. They have branches in UK.

With Western Union, it's a case of needing to be certain that the recipient is trustworthy. By sending money, the recipient could pick it up and you'd have no come-back if they never sent goods.

I HAVE used it buy from China several years ago, and only did so because the seller I was buying from (on Ebay) had very high, very positive feedback. It was all fine - received exactly what I paid for and made several more orders, not a problem.

I would suggest that if you do not know anyone who has used this company before i.e. this is NOT based on a recommendation, then do not send money via Western Union, certainly not a high amount. Perhaps you might want to send a small amount for a sample of goods - if they come through, increase the orders gradually. If nothing arrives, then you've only lost a small amount - write it off against future profits!

I've dealt with Chinese Companies for years, both big, small and one man bands. On first transactions they usually want 20-30% up front payment which is reasonable to prove you are reliable.

All wanted their money paid into their bank accounts.

I also have heard Western Union horror stories but do not know exactly how the con(s) work. I would not use it!
I guess they are middle men who receive your money and
"disappear" and you don't get the goods.

Do remember dealing with China at low value levels is very Wild West territory! Ask for their bank account details and say you will pay 20% now and the remainng 70% when they fax/email you the Bill of Lading details.
